10 miniature medals anang- ed on bar-C.B., C.M.G., D.S.Ō. An Egyptian medal and six other medals valued at £50..
A gold cigarette case, square pattern with patent slide open- ing action, made by Gold- smiths and Silversmiths Com London, valued at £30.
A silver packet watch of Swiss make ("Omega") valued at £25..
A pair of plain gold cuff links valued at $10.
A pair of enamel gold cuff links with the Cameron Crest in enamel on all four faces, valued at £15 (made by Gold- smiths and Silversmiths Co., London)
A pair of tortoiseshell spec tacles in a flat fabric case, valued at $20.
A bunch of eight small keys. $1.20 in loose money,
The total value is given at $1,700.

To-day's weather report from the Royal Observatory states: The depression has deepen ed. It is now about 300 miles 3.8.W. of Tokyo, moving East- ward. Another has formed over Tongking.
Forecast:-E. or S.E. winds; moderate: generally cloudy; occasional rain,

TRAGEDY OF RAIN. OVER 2,500 FAMILIES HÕMELESS IN SMYRNA.
£2,000,000 DAMAGE.
Constantinople, Yesterday. Mosques and school buildings in Smyrna have been turned into shelters for 2,500 families ren- dered homeless through the de vastating tains, which have al ready caused 194 deaths, many more missing, and £2,000,000 worth of damage-Reuter.
